    Dual head mode: choppy video playback on only one of my two screens

    Hello

    I'm having problems playing back video on my second monitor. My primary monitor is a 21" CRT and I use my flat screen TV as a second monitor. Playing video on my primary monitor works fine, no choppiness. But playing back the same video on the other, flat screen TV, monitor results in choppy video playback. Not constant choppiness, but rather one big chop every 1-2 seconds.

    My xorg.conf is attached.

    $ lspci | grep ATI
    01:00.0 VGA compatible controller: ATI Technologies Inc Radeon HD 3870
    01:00.1 Audio device: ATI Technologies Inc Radeon HD 3870 Audio device
